Hahnemann’s Materia medica consists ofsymptoms from different sources: provingsymptoms, poisoning symptoms and thesymptoms of patients emerging duringmedical treatment. All these symptomshave different meanings for the medicalpractice. These meanings will be lookedinto with the help of case studies.

The central council for research inHomeopathy (CCRH) has undertaken drugproving of 78 indigenous/partially provedremedies on a well designed double blindprotocol. The entire process has taken 2-3

years. The voluminous data of subjective symptomatic changeshas been compiled, sifted and sieved. The final proving data hasbeen passed on to the clinical verification units and clinicallyverified data has been obtained. This paper contains theclinically verified data of the proved remedies which meritinclusion in the Homeopathic Materia medica.

The Niendorf Materia-medica-Project is aninternational cooperative effort to updateour Materia medica and repertories fromprovings and cured cases which have notyet been integrated. A series of Materiamedica lectures which began in

Niendorf in 2006 was the first step of this important initiative.Physicians from seven countries are currently working togetherto complete this enormous but very essential task. In the firstpart, Dr. André Saine will explain the raison d’être and themethodology of the project. In his second lecture, Dr. Sainewill demonstrate first results achieved by this project andillustrate its immediate practical benefits to the practitioner.

In homeopathy, symptoms from patientsand drug provings are not consideredtrivial and as mere measured data. In fact,the perception, registration and practicaluse of symptoms depend on the (homeo-

pathic) theory applied. For this reason, a revision of the Materiamedica requires a common understanding and consensus abouta reliable critical theory of homeopathy.
